[Timeline] Foot IK property has no affect on the animation when Timeline preview is played
Steps to reproduce:
1. Open the provided project "Foot IK Timeline preview.zip"
2. Select the "New Timeline" GameObject in the Hierarchy window
3. In the Timeline window select "New animation" Animation track
4. Press play to preview the animation
5. In the Inspector window check and uncheck Foot IK property while the animation is running
Expected results: Foot IK property affects the animation
Actual results: Foot IK property does not affect the animation when Timeline preview is played
Reproducible with: Timeline 1.1.0 (2019.3.0a8), Timeline 1.2.6 (2019.3.0b11), Timeline 1.3.0 (2020.1.0a13)
Not reproducible with: Timeline 1.1.0 (2019.2.13f1),Timeline 1.1.0 (2019.3.0a7)
Note: While in Play Mode, Foot IK property affects the animation
